FIGURE 2. A in A Miocene ant species of the genus Forelius Emery, 1888 (Hymenoptera: Formicidae: Dolichoderinae) from Mexico

FIGURE 2. A Forelius chenpauch sp. nov. Holotype CPAL.464. Microphotograph augmentation of dorsolateral showing: head (h); foreleg (fl); gaster (ga); mesonotum (mnt); petiole (p); pronotum (pn); propodeal spiracle (ps); scape (sc). B Forelius chenpauch sp. nov. Drawing of Holotype CPAL.464 showing: clypeus (clv); compound eye (ey); foreleg (fl); gaster (ga); mandible (mn); mesonotum (mnt); petiole (p); pronotum (pn); propodeum (ppm); propodeal spiracle (ps); scape (sc); striae (str).
